How to Make Vegan & Gluten-Free Pistachio Cookies
Ingredients
- 1 cup almond flour
- 1/2 cup pistachios, chopped
- 1/4 cup maple syrup or agave nectar
- 1/4 cup coconut oil, melted
- 1 teaspoon vanilla extract
- 1/2 teaspoon baking soda
- 1/4 teaspoon salt
Directions
- Preheat the oven to 350°F (175°C) and line a baking sheet with parchment paper.
- In a large bowl, mix together the almond flour, chopped pistachios, baking soda, and salt.
- In another bowl, whisk together the maple syrup, melted coconut oil, and vanilla extract.
- Combine the wet and dry ingredients and mix until a dough forms.
- Scoop tablespoon-sized portions of dough onto the prepared baking sheet, spacing them about 2 inches apart.
- Bake for 10-12 minutes, until the edges are golden.
- Allow to cool on the baking sheet for a few minutes before transferring them to a wire rack to cool completely.

How to Store Vegan & Gluten-Free Pistachio Cookies
Store your cookies in an airtight container at room temperature for up to a week. If you want to keep them longer, you can freeze the cookies for up to 3 months. Just make sure to separate the layers with parchment paper to prevent them from sticking together.
Tips to Make Vegan & Gluten-Free Pistachio Cookies
- Make sure to measure the almond flour accurately for the best texture.
- You can adjust the sweetness by adding more or less maple syrup, depending on your taste.
- If you want a more intense pistachio flavor, try adding a few drops of pistachio extract to the wet ingredients.

FAQs
1. Can I use another flour instead of almond flour?
You can try using other gluten-free flours, but almond flour gives the best texture and flavor for these cookies.
2. Is there a nut-free version of these cookies?
Yes! You can replace almond flour with oat flour or sunflower seed flour for a nut-free option.
3. Can I make these cookies ahead of time?
Absolutely! You can make the dough in advance and freeze it. Just scoop the dough onto a baking sheet and freeze. Once frozen, transfer the dough balls to a container. Bake them fresh when you need them!
